The goal of Church and Community Ministry is to impact the community, society, and world for Christ by helping churches connect with their communities in relevant ways and to share the Gospel through meeting needs.
Community Ministry includes: Servanthood Evangelism...a combination of simple acts of kindness and intentional personal evangelism, and Ministry Evangelism... meeting persons at the point of their need and ministering to them physically and spiritually.
Consultation, training, and resources are available to enable churches to better evaluate the needs of their community, the abilities and resources of their congregation, and the ministry opportunities God has provided for their church.
